Common NameSM(d18:0/22:0)
Description(2-{[(2S)-3-hydroxy-2-[(1-hydroxydocosylidene)amino]octadecyl phosphonato]oxy}ethyl)trimethylazanium belongs to the class of organic compounds known as phosphosphingolipids. These are sphingolipids with a structure based on a sphingoid base that is attached to a phosphate head group. They differ from phosphonospingolipids which have a phosphonate head group.
